The Ministry of Internal Affairs and Communications (MIC) mandates compulsory certification for telecommunications equipment in Japan under the Telecommunications Business Act. This act, established in 1984, stipulates in Article 68 that MIC authorizes qualified agencies to implement conformity assessment of technical standards. JATE certification is the colloquial term for Japan's Telecommunications Business Act certification, which typically requires mobile phone products to meet the testing requirements of both the Telecommunications Business Act (commonly known as JATE certification) and the Radio Law (commonly known as telec certification) for legal market entry.
